Where are you from and what do you find inspirational about where you’re living?
I’m currently living in Berlin but originally come from a smaller town in North Rhine-Westphalia. For me is Berlin a very inspiring city, the culture of electronic music here is very pronounced and completely arrived in the society. In my case is Berlin the techno capital city worldwide. There are many nightclubs, so many that I do not know once. I love to live here and have access to the music infrastructure.

For people who don’t know much about you, could you tell us a bit about your music background? How did you fall down the music rabbit hole?
Music has accompanied me throughout my life, but everything has started with Hip Hop at the end of the 90s, at that time there were no CD’s. So I was forced with a cassette recorder to record music from the TV. Later I cut my favourite songs from several cassettes to a mixtape. When the Wu-Tang hype arrived Germany I came the first time in contact with scratches, from this time I wanted to be a DJ, but it took me a while until I had saved enough money to buy the legendary Technics 1210. That was the beginning.

Tell us a bit about early passions and influences? Is there something or someone who had a huge impact on you?
In 2001, I got the Mix “Banging The Box 5” from DJ Mastermind Bad Boy Bill, he combined professional DJ techniques with electronic music, I had never heard of such a thing before and became a fan. Afterwards, I switched completely to electronic music, at that time funky house, so I think he has the biggest influence.

What can we expect from your guest mix?
A Doncler set is a journey. I try to catch the listener with a unique sound. I really listen the most of the releases every day and spend a lot of time to find gold nuggets. I try to surprise listeners with music they do not know and hope to trigger positive emotions.

Fast forward 5 years. Where do you stand? What is one thing that would make your musical career more successful?
I started producing my own music and I hope that I get a larger fanbase in the future. In October I signed a label and management deal at a young agency named “Berlin Banger Records“. That is my chance to get a bigger international audience.
